Cliosport always seem to have bad locations at shows. Weekend racer/corsasport, who I'm staff on, fight to get a decent location, inc requesting far more stand passes than drivers (so often inc stand passes for passengers), which really helps.

Cliosport certainly doesn't do things as well, and I do echo the comments in this thread that FCS isn't as well organised as other shows, fresh in my mind is Castle Combe action days as a good comparison.

We are always looking for new shows to attend to be honest, one of the reasons we started CSS was because we didn't like some aspects of the other shows, and wanted to do our own thing.

If there were more options then we would certainly look at attending them either in addition or as an alternative. We'd also like a good winter show (obviously somewhere that has indoor facilities) as it's a bit pants that the clubs social events are all within about 3 months of the year, then nothing for 9 months.

We had a crap stand location last year, and Mark improved that for us this year. Unfortunately the space we were given for over 60 cars at the weekend was way too small, causing a number of parking issues and trapping people in when they wanted to leave.

I'm sure we will feedback our members opinions if asked. FCS used to hold a post FCS meeting to get feedback from club admins, but I don't think that happens any more (or if it does we're not invited lol).
